PC Magazine: Not Even Close

Sun, Sep 12, 2004 at 2:01:36 pm PDT

An article by Edward Mendelson at PC Magazine claims to have debunked my comparisons of the CBS News Killian documents with my versions typed in MS Word: Bush’s Exam Doc — Real or Fake?

To prove his case that the Killian documents could have been typed on an IBM Selectric Composer (and let’s leave aside the issue of why Jerry Killian, who his family said did not type, would have used the most complicated and expensive typewriter available to type short memos, only to file them away), Mendelson includes two postage stamp-sized images of a fully justified paragraph typed in MS Word and on an IBM Composer, and claims that they are an exact match.

Well, sorry Edward, but when you overlay your two tiny images, this is what you get:

I aligned these two images on the word “The” at upper left. Calling this a match is completely ridiculous. A person writing for PC Magazine really ought to know better than to try to pull off such an obvious flimflam.

Now this, on the other hand, is a perfect match.
